>> Marvin,
>> 
>> You cannot attach files to your emails when you're sending an email to
>> this list. But regardless of your code:
>> 
>> 1. Setting up your SMTP is not a PHP issue, it depends on your operating
>> system.
>> 2. I expect you're using Windows. As far as I know, there is not an easy
>> solution about running an SMTP server on Windows. What I did was to find
>> someone who would let me play with the SMTP server running on his Linux box.
>> 
>> But of course, if anyone has done this on Windows, I'd appreciate it if
>> they could step forward and help you.
